Lip Oil vs Lip Gloss l Difference Between Lip Oil & Lip Gloss

Lip care items have become an integral part of skincare and self-care routines. An individual can find various options available in the market, confusing picking the best product suitable for your skin type. In this blog, we will help you decide which product is best for your lips.

Difference Between Lip Oil and Lip Gloss

Lip oils are formulated uniquely to provide maximum hydration to the lips; alternatively, lip glosses are formulated to add shine and colour to the lips. They both have different purposes and uses to keep the lips hydrated and healthy.

What is the Difference Between Lip Oil and Lip Gloss?

Lip gloss and lip oil contain different ingredients compared to each other, as lip oil contains hydrating oils like jojoba oil, argan oil, and coconut oil, along with nourishing vitamins and antioxidant properties. These ingredients lead to a lightweight, non-sticky texture.

The main purpose of lip oil is to provide hydration and nourishment. It can also be worn under lipstick. On the contrary, lip gloss contains a mix of waxes, oils, and polymers to create a glossy finish, along with shimmers, pigments, and flavouring. They can be found in various textures, such as lightweight, sticky, and non-sticky.

What is Lip Oil?

Lip oils are oil-based cosmetics designed for the lips, providing moisturizing effects. They can leave a subtle or glossy sheen and can be tinted or untinted. By using plant-based oils to nourish and moisturise the lips, they promote the function of the lip barrier and hydration.

How to Use Lip Oil?

Daily Use for Dry Lips

Apply lip oil daily by exfoliating dry lips, evenly applying it over lipstick for shine and hydration, and reapplying as needed, especially after meals or prolonged outdoor exposure.

As a Lip Prep Before Lipstick

Before applying lipstick, massage some lip oil into your lips and let it soak in for a few minutes. Exfoliate your lips before applying for a smoother application.

Overnight Lip Treatment

Apply a thick layer of lip oil before bed, allowing it to work as you sleep, ensuring deep hydration and mend, leaving your lips smooth and moisturised in the morning.

How to Use Lip Gloss

On Top of Lipstick

You can apply a lip gloss on lipstick for a glossy finish by using a matte lipstick as a base and lightly applying a thin film, avoiding excessive application to prevent stickiness and quick wear.

Alone for a Natural Sheen

Swipe a single coat of gloss across your lips for a natural, dewy finish, focusing on the center for larger lips. Layer the gloss for intensity or use it over lipstick for a dramatic finish.

For a Glam, Glossy Makeup Look

For a glam, glossy lip appearance, layer lip gloss over lipstick for a shiny finish. Reapply lip gloss throughout the day to achieve a fuller impression, and more shine, focusing on the middle of the lips.
